Steel is manufactured by using one of two major smelting procedures — possibly a blast furnace or An electrical arc furnace.

In modern facilities, the Preliminary product or service is close to the final composition which is constantly cast into prolonged slabs, Slash and formed into bars and extrusions and heat dealt with to generate a remaining products. Today, about 96% of steel is repeatedly cast, when only four% is developed as ingots.[16]
